Why Software Support Matters in Android Phones
Software support includes regular updates, security patches, and new features that extend the lifespan of a device. Android phones with strong support typically receive updates directly from manufacturers or carriers, which helps protect against vulnerabilities and ensures compatibility with new apps and services. Choosing a device with good support can save money in the long run by avoiding the need for frequent replacements.

Google Pixel A Series
The Google Pixel A series, including models like Pixel 6a and Pixel 7a, is renowned for receiving timely Android updates directly from Google. These devices typically get security patches and OS updates within days of release, making them a top choice for longevity and support at an affordable price point.
Samsung Galaxy A Series
The Samsung Galaxy A series offers a range of budget-friendly phones that benefit from Samsung’s commitment to software updates. Recent models are expected to receive at least three years of security updates and two major Android OS upgrades, ensuring they remain secure and feature-rich.
OnePlus Nord Series
OnePlus devices, especially the Nord series, are known for their clean user interface and prompt software updates. OnePlus has improved its update policy, providing at least two years of OS updates and three years of security patches for recent models.
Motorola Moto G Series
The Motorola Moto G series offers affordable smartphones with a focus on durability and software support. While not as rapid as Pixel or Samsung, Motorola provides regular security updates and has committed to longer support cycles for recent models.
Xiaomi Redmi Note Series
Xiaomi’s Redmi Note series provides excellent value, with many models receiving MIUI updates and security patches regularly. While software updates may be slightly slower than other brands, Xiaomi’s commitment to support has improved over recent years.
Choosing the Right Device for Long-Term Support
When selecting an affordable Android phone, consider the manufacturer’s update policy, community support, and the device’s hardware capabilities. Devices like Google Pixel and Samsung Galaxy A series are generally the safest bets for receiving timely updates. Additionally, checking online forums and user reviews can provide insights into ongoing support and software stability.
